Tropical Storm Amanda has formed in the Pacific Ocean, marking the first tropical cyclone of the Pacific hurricane season, according to the National Hurricane Center.
Storm Details
The storm developed on Wednesday, June 3, 2026, and its center remains at sea, posing no immediate threat to land. Meteorologists are monitoring its path but currently expect no impact on coastal areas.
Season Context
The Pacific hurricane season officially began on May 15, while the Atlantic hurricane season started on Monday, June 1. No cyclones have yet formed in the Atlantic basin this year.
The National Hurricane Center continues to track tropical weather patterns and will provide updates as necessary.
